Punjab Assembly approves 40 demands for grant
By Or Correspondent
June 25, 2021
LAHORE: Punjab Assembly Thursday gave approval to 40 demands of grant and all the cut motions moved by the opposition were rejected by majority vote. The assembly session began with a delay of over two hours with Speaker Ch Pervaiz Elahi in the chair. The demands for grant were approved by the House and all the motions moved by the opposition for a cut in the expenditures of the government were rejected. Provincial Minister for School Education Murad Raas grilled the opposition for destroying the province. Azma Bokhari of the PML-N was also served a defamation notice for accusing the chief minister over minting commission in the name of transfer and postings.
